#293e40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#293e40 is composed of 16.1% red, 24.3%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.9% cyan, 3.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 185.2 degrees, a saturation of 21.9% and a lightness of 20.6%. #293e40 color hex could be obtained by blending #527c80 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#293e40 color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#293e40 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#293e40 has RGB values of R:41, G:62,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 2702912.

Shades and Tints of #293e40
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030404 is the darkest color, while #f7faf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#293e40
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#313738 is the less saturated color, while #015f68 is the most saturated one.
